Output 9c77c24a34415971b0232532fdb788a47ae19511689d4735849131c957a999d1:0

value
15898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c3e3531f7ca560b78b07760991733db307c043 OP_EQUAL
address
3CF8J95uKfbr6jy5TZQ3Zuo7pi5bEH8NWV
transaction
9c77c24a34415971b0232532fdb788a47ae19511689d4735849131c957a999d1
confirmations
50145
spent
false

1 Sat Range